The Meaning of Proverbs 22:4 Explained

Proverbs 22:4

KJV: By humility and the fear of the LORD are riches, and honour, and life.

YLT: The end of humility is the fear of Jehovah, Riches, and honour, and life.

Darby: The reward of humility and the fear of Jehovah is riches, and honour, and life.

ASV: The reward of humility and the fear of Jehovah Is riches, and honor, and life.

Proverbs 22:1-16 - "he That Loveth Pureness Of Heart"
Great riches are not always a great blessing. When they are held in trust for God, they afford the opportunity of giving a vast amount of happiness to the benefactor as well as to those benefited. But we recall other riches, which do not consist in what a man has, but in what he is. There are four levels of human experience-to have, to do, to know, and to be-and these in their order are like iron, silver, gold, precious stones.
Some of these riches are enumerated here: a good name and loving favor, Proverbs 22:1; the faith that hides in God, Proverbs 22:3; true humility and godly fear, Proverbs 22:4; the child-heart, Proverbs 22:6; the beautiful eye and open hand, Proverbs 22:9; purity of heart and thought, Proverbs 22:11; alacrity and diligence, Proverbs 22:13. If only we would cultivate the inward graces and gifts of our soul-life, all who feel our influence would be proportionately enriched. [source]

What do the individual words in Proverbs 22:4 mean?

By humility [and] the fear of Yahweh [Are] riches and honor and life
עֵ֣קֶב עֲ֭נָוָה יִרְאַ֣ת יְהוָ֑ה עֹ֖שֶׁר וְכָב֣וֹד וְחַיִּֽים

עֲ֭נָוָה  humility 
Parse: Noun, feminine singular
Root: עֲנָוָה  
Sense: humility, meekness.
יִרְאַ֣ת  [and]  the  fear 
Parse: Noun, feminine singular construct
Root: יִרְאָה  
Sense: fear, terror, fearing.
יְהוָ֑ה  of  Yahweh 
Parse: Proper Noun, masculine singular
Root: יהוה 
Sense: the proper name of the one true God.
עֹ֖שֶׁר  [Are]  riches 
Parse: Noun, masculine singular
Root: עֹשֶׁר  
Sense: wealth, riches.
וְכָב֣וֹד  and  honor 
Parse: Conjunctive waw, Noun, masculine singular
Root: כָּבֹוד  
Sense: glory, honour, glorious, abundance.
וְחַיִּֽים  and  life 
Parse: Conjunctive waw, Noun, masculine plural
Root: חַי 
Sense: living, alive.
